Decoding the 020 Prefix: London Calling
The “020” prefix is a geographical area code specifically assigned to London, United Kingdom. This tells us, with reasonable certainty, that the phone number 02045996879 is associated with a landline located within the London metropolitan area. It replaced the older 0171 and 0181 codes in 2000 as London’s phone network expanded. This change was part of a larger national number change designed to create more available phone numbers.
The Structure of UK Phone Numbers:
Understanding the structure of UK phone numbers beyond the area code provides further insight. After the 020 area code, there is an eight-digit local number. This local number is unique within the London area. Combined, the 020 prefix and the eight-digit number constitute a complete UK landline phone number.
What You Can Deduce from a Phone Number:
- Geographical Location (General): As discussed, the 020 prefix indicates a London landline. However, pinpointing the exact address is not possible simply from the phone number. That information is protected.
- Type of Number (Landline vs. Mobile): The 020 prefix definitively identifies this as a landline number. Mobile numbers in the UK use different prefixes, such as 07.
